Mark, i weigh 150 and need to know what duro bushings to get for my Glenn g-trucks. I will be using these for TS

Posted: Mon Jan 05, 2004 4:16 am
by Glenn S
Hunter,
The trucks I sent you should be pretty damn good at your weight with the blue G*Truck bushings for a front truck, and the white Tracker bushing I trimmed down to fix for the rear. For starters at least.

I do have a feeling that the Radikal urethane would be even better though than even that stock blue G*Truck bushings which are better than the clear Bones Blues in rebound. I've put trimmed down Stimulator bushings in my G*Trucks and it just makes them come alive, and Radikal bushing have the same type high-rebound urethane, maybe better.

But there is the possiblilty that the Radikal bushings might have a larger Outside Diameter than would fit the hanger bushing cups and the bushing cup on the baseplate of the G*Truck. This is easy to trim down if you have the right tools, a bench grinder and a drill is best/quickest I think.

But just so you know the bushing cups on those G*Trucks for the baseplate and hanger are smaller than either Tracker or Indy, the stock G*Truck bushing has a smaller OD than most. And most other bushings I've tried need a slight trim. My guess is that you'd need to trim Radikal bushings to fit.

My understanding is that the Radikal bushings have an exact heigth of 9/16". Could anyone here tell us the OD measurement of the Radikal bushings?
